Earthquake tremor shakes Maltese localities

An earthquake shook a number of Maltese localities at around 0545CET on Friday. No injuries or damages have been reported as yet. The earthquake marked 4.9 on the Richter scale and occurred in the Central Mediterranean Sea. Its epicenter was located 155 km (95 miles) North West of Valletta, Malta.

The tremor lasted between two and three seconds was mostly felt in towns located in the Northwest regions of Malta. According to USGS, the eathquake was located at 36.466°N, 12.934°E.

The Civil Protection Department and the Police received numerous calls from alarmed citizens who felt the tremor, however no casualties were reported. This year another two earthquake tremors were felt in August and January.
